package org.apache.activemq.artemis.spi.core.remoting;

import org.apache.activemq.artemis.api.core.ActiveMQException;
import org.apache.activemq.artemis.core.server.ActiveMQComponent;

/**
 * A ConnectionLifeCycleListener is called by the remoting implementation to notify of connection events.
 */
public interface BaseConnectionLifeCycleListener {

   /**
    * This method is used both by client connector creation and server connection creation through
    * acceptors. On the client side the {@code component} parameter is normally passed as
    * {@code null}.
    * 

* Leaving this method here and adding a different one at * {@code ServerConnectionLifeCycleListener} is a compromise for a reasonable split between the * activemq-server and activemq-client packages while avoiding to pull too much into activemq-core. * The pivotal point keeping us from removing the method is {@link ConnectorFactory} and the * usage of it. * * @param component This will probably be an {@code Acceptor} and only used on the server side. * @param connection the connection that has been created * @param protocol the messaging protocol type this connection uses */ void connectionCreated(ActiveMQComponent component, Connection connection, ProtocolClass protocol); /** * Called when a connection is destroyed. * * @param connectionID the connection being destroyed. */ void connectionDestroyed(Object connectionID); /** * Called when an error occurs on the connection. * * @param connectionID the id of the connection. * @param me the exception. */ void connectionException(Object connectionID, ActiveMQException me); void connectionReadyForWrites(Object connectionID, boolean ready); }
